Subject: "BUG: scheduling while atomic" on 5.4 kernels with PREEMPT_RT

I ran into an issue with Wireguard on Linux 5.4 kernels with the 
PREEMPT_RT patch, on Ubuntu 18.04. I tried kernels 5.4.47-rt28 and 
5.4.82-rt45.
Everything is fine until I send actual data to the machine through scp, 
resulting in the kernel log below stating "BUG: scheduling while 
atomic".
I tried both the latest Ubuntu package (with wireguard-dkms version 
1.0.20201112) as well as compiling the kernel module from the latest 
source from the wireguard-linux-compat repo, with the same result.

Since the call trace mentions kernel_fpu_begin, I looked at the code and 
the issue seems to occur while using SIMD for packet decryption.

When I forcibly disable SIMD with this simple bypass:
  static inline void simd_get(simd_context_t *ctx)
  {
-    *ctx = !IS_ENABLED(CONFIG_PREEMPT_RT_BASE) && may_use_simd() ? 
HAVE_FULL_SIMD : HAVE_NO_SIMD;
+    *ctx = HAVE_NO_SIMD;
  }
indeed everything works fine again (ignoring the performance hit).

I was unable to further pinpoint the issue, unfortunately.
Any idea what might be the cause?
